Magmatism and Eurekan deformation in the High Arctic Large Igneous Province:40Ar–39Ar age of Kap Washington Group volcanics, North Greenland

The High Arctic Large Igneous Province is unusual on two counts: first, magmatism was prolonged and has been suggested to include an initial tholeiitic phase (130–80 Ma) and a second alkaline phase (85–60 Ma); second, it was subsequently deformed during the Eurekan Orogeny.
